| Reverse description | Full-length figure of Tyche standing to the left, wearing a kalathos (modius) on her head, rendered in the conventional Hellenistic civic goddess type. She holds a large cornucopia in her left arm and two stalks of corn (wheat ears) in her outstretched right hand. The reverse field carries a divided Greek legend recording the regnal year KΘ (year 29) under King Agrippa II, split as ΕΤΟΥ - ΚΘ ΒΑ above and ΑΓΡΙ-ΠΠΑ in the lower field, providing a precise dated reference to the era of Agrippa II (77-78 CE). |
